Dessert Funnel Cakes
You will need enough oil to fill a skillet 2 inches and a funnel to drip the batter into the hot
oil. Serve hot as a snack or dessert dusted with powdered sugar. * Vegetable or canola oil for
deep-frying * 1 egg * -2/3 cup milk * 1-1/3 cups all-purpose flour * 2 tablespoons sugar * ¼
teaspoon salt * ¾ teaspoon baking powder
Fill a large skillet with enough oil to come up 2 inches in the pan. Heat to 375 degrees using a
candy or deep-fry thermometer. Whisk egg into milk and sift flour, sugar, salt and baking powder
into another bowl. Blend egg and milk mixture into the flour and beat until smooth. Lace about 1 cup
of the batter at a time into a funnel, holding the hole closed with a fingertip. Allow the batter to
flow from the funnel into the hot oil and swirl batter several times in coiled, snake-like pattern.
Deep-fry 1 to 2 minutes on each side, or until golden brown. Drain on paper towels and sprinkle with
powdered sugar, if you wish. Repeat with remaining batter. Makes about a dozen large coils or 2
dozen small coils.
Source: Culinaria The United States, (Konemann, 1998). Per serving (based on 12 without oil for
frying): 72 calories (13 percent from fat), 0.9 g fat (0.4 g saturated, 0.3 g monounsaturated), 19
mg cholesterol, 2.4 g protein, 13.2 g carbohydrates, 0.4 g fiber, 90.4 mg sodium.
